Automation testing is the process of using specialized software tools to execute test cases automatically, compare actual results with expected outcomes and reduce human intervention for faster and more reliable testing.

Automation testing improves test coverage, reduces testing time, ensures consistency in results, allows frequent regression testing and helps teams deliver high-quality software faster and more efficiently.

Popular automation testing tools include Selenium, QTP/UFT, TestComplete, Appium, Cypress and Robot Framework, each suited for different platforms and testing needs.

Automation testing complements manual testing but cannot replace it entirely, especially for exploratory, usability and ad-hoc testing where human judgment is required.

Time savings depend on test complexity and frequency, but automation can reduce regression testing cycles by up to 50–70% compared to manual execution.

Some tools require coding knowledge (e.g., Selenium), while codeless automation tools allow testers to create tests visually without programming expertise.

Automated tests should ideally run after every build or code change, especially regression and smoke tests, to quickly detect defects and maintain software quality.

Yes — tools like Appium, Espresso and XCUITest enable automation testing on mobile applications across different operating systems and devices.

Test scripts should be maintained regularly by updating them with new features, removing obsolete tests and ensuring compatibility with updated application versions.

Common challenges include high initial setup cost, selecting the right tools, maintaining test scripts, handling dynamic UI changes and ensuring team skillsets match automation requirements.
